The Honchizon #10 Dog Clipper Blade is a full-tooth A5 replacement blade that leaves approximately 1/16 in. (1.5 mm) of coat. It is a core grooming size for distributors building an everyday blade range: close enough for clean, professional body work, yet versatile enough to remain useful across routine salon services. The detachable A5 format allows grooming-tool wholesalers and private-label brands to offer a familiar replacement option for customers already using compatible Andis, Wahl, Oster and Heiniger clipper systems.
| Blade size | #10 |
|---|---|
| Cutting length | 1/16 in. / 1.5 mm |
| Blade type | Full tooth, detachable A5 style |
| Compatible systems | A5 systems; compatible with specified Andis, Wahl, Oster and Heiniger clipper models |
| Material options | Stainless steel, high carbon steel, or ceramic-cutter configuration |
The #10 is commonly selected for close, tidy clipping where a short finish is required without moving to an extra-close #30 or #40 blade. It is well suited to sanitary work, pad and paw-area cleaning, face and ear-area detail work, and short body clipping on coats that have been washed, dried and brushed through. For wholesale assortments, it works as a high-rotation utility blade alongside longer finish blades such as 3F, 4F, 5F and 7F. It can also serve as a base blade for compatible snap-on guide comb programs, subject to the comb system used.
Stainless steel is the practical choice for buyers seeking corrosion resistance and a straightforward all-purpose offer. High carbon steel is often chosen where sharpness retention is a priority, provided normal blade-care practices are followed. A ceramic-cutter configuration is relevant for professional users who want to manage heat during longer clipping sessions. These are material and configuration choices rather than interchangeable marketing labels: the chosen option should match the intended price point, customer use frequency and maintenance expectations.
Remove loose hair after each use, apply clipper-blade oil to the moving contact points, and run the clipper briefly to distribute the oil. Check blade temperature during extended work and allow the blade to cool before changing or storing it. A clean, dry, well-brushed coat helps reduce drag and preserves cutting performance. Blades should be cleaned and dried before storage; oil is a lubricant, not a substitute for removing hair and residue.
